This set of patches adds definitions and dependencies for the FEniCS Project.
FEniCS provides a problem-solving environment for general classes of problems
that involve differential equations. It is particularly well-suited to
problems that can be solved using the Finite Element Method.
There are two main packages;
i) fenics-dolfin: C++ library plus interface
ii) python-fenics-dolfin: Python interface
There are four FEniCS dependencies:
i) python-fenics-ffc
ii) python-fenics-fiat
iii) python-fenics-ufl
iv) python-fenics-dijitso
There are three external dependencies:
i) python-slepc4py
ii) python-petsc4py
iii) python-mpi4py
There is an extra package 'fenics' that inherits its defintion from
python-fenics-dolfin. This is to provide a sensible default for users
expecting to find a package of this name.
